Growing Awareness Amongst The Patient Population Regarding Hospital-Acquired Infections (HAI) Is Expected To Drive Sterilization Equipment Market Growth Till 2025:Grand View Research,Inc.
The global sterilization equipment market is expected to
reach USD 9.8 billion by 2025, according to a new study by Grand View Research
Inc. Increasing number of hospital stays and growing awareness amongst the
patient population regarding hospital-acquired infections (HAI) are propelling
the market growth at a global level. Sterilization of medical devices is
significant in order to prevent the spread of diseases such as AIDS.
Furthermore, proper sterilization
of medical devices also prevents additional surgeries required to treat
infections caused by the use of unsterilized devices, thus reducing cost and
life-threatening complications. According to various research studies and
statistics, sterilization shows almost 100% effective results with the least
rate of contamination in hospitals and other medical institutions.

Further Key Findings from
the Study Suggest:
- Heat sterilization technique dominated the overall
market in 2015, as it is the most widely used method for the sterilization
of maximum medical equipment
- In addition, glassware such as flasks, petri dishes,
pipette, burette, and glass syringes are the most compatible with heat
sterilization
- Low-temperature sterilization is anticipated to grow
at the highest CAGR during the forecast period since the technique is used
to sterilize heat-sensitive and moisture-sensitive loads with high
efficiency as it destroys even the microorganisms
- Hospitals segment occupied the largest share in 2014.
The segment is also expected to witness the highest growth rate during the
forecast period as most of the medical equipment find its application in
hospitals.
- North America dominated the segment with the largest
revenue share in 2015 due to greater technological advancement, growing
awareness, and highly developed healthcare infrastructure.
- Increasing number of surgical procedures in hospitals
is aggressively propelling the demand for sterilization equipment in North
America, which is expected to boost the growth in North America
- Asia Pacific is anticipated to show a significant
growth during the forecast period, mainly due to increasing government
initiatives, large pool of patient population, and increasing incidence of
hospital-acquired infections
- Some of the major companies operating in this market
are STERIS plc; Getinge AB, Advanced Sterilization Products Services,
Inc.; 3M; Belimed; Cantel Medical; MATACHANA GROUP; Sterigenics
International LLC; and TSO3.
